I found this park that was nothing short of a wheat field. I pulled 2 memorial pennies and the rest were all wheat pennies dating from the heart stopping 1909 to 1959. The best find at this park was, I swung over a flower bed and the at pro screamed. this meant it was pretty close to a surface find and it was marked a penny on the id. I stuck my hand down in the dirty, sandy, mulch and pulled a 1904 IH off the surface. :dontknow: I managed 1 silver 1920 merc out of there and that was about it. I have made 2 more trips back to the park but have come home with only clad and junk. My wife brought me home a nice 64 quarter out of her register at work and my sister gave me 37 merc she received in change.
